Filing 96 ORDER Granting 95 Stipulation Seeking a Final Judgment Pursuant to Rule 54(B). IT IS HEREBY ORDERED that the Clerk of Court enter a Judgment reflecting the Order issued on July 13, 2015 75 , stating that:IT IS ORDERED that 12 U.S.C. § 4617(j)(3) preempts Nevada Revised Statutes§ 116.3116 to the extent that a homeowner association's foreclosure of its super-priority lien cannot extinguish a property interest of Freddie Mac while it is under FHFA's conservatorship. A ccordingly, the HOA's foreclosure sale of its super-priority lien did not extinguish Freddie Macs interest in the Property secured by the Deed of Trust or convey the Property free and clear to Plaintiff.I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that Freddie Mac, FHFA, Chase, and MERS are granted summary judgment on Plaintiff's claim for declaratory relief / quiet title. Freddie Mac, FHFA, Chase, and MERS are also granted summary judgment on their quiet title and declaratory judgment counterclaims.I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that the Court determines that this is a final and appealable judgment pursuant to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 54(b) as there is no just reason for delay. Signed by Chief Judge Gloria M. Navarro on 11/25/15. (Copies have been distributed pursuant to the NEF - PS) |
